What Is a Carbon Emissions Calculator?

A Carbon Emissions Calculator is a tool used to estimate greenhouse gas emissions generated by different activities. Depending on the calculator, it may consider factors such as transportation, electricity consumption, fuel usage, heating, flights, and other energy-related activities.

The basic concept is straightforward: activity data is combined with an appropriate emissions factor to estimate the resulting emissions.

For example, if you know how much fuel a vehicle consumes, the calculator can use the amount of fuel and a corresponding emissions factor to estimate the CO₂e produced. Similarly, electricity consumption can be used with an applicable electricity emissions factor to estimate emissions from household or business energy use.

The result is an estimate rather than a precise measurement. Actual emissions can vary depending on fuel type, vehicle efficiency, electricity generation methods, location, and other factors.

Carbon Emissions and Carbon Footprints

The terms carbon emissions and carbon footprint are closely related but can have slightly different meanings. Carbon emissions generally refer to greenhouse gases released into the atmosphere as a result of activities such as burning fossil fuels.

A carbon footprint represents the overall greenhouse gas emissions associated with a person, activity, organization, product, or service.

Carbon dioxide is one of the most important greenhouse gases, but other gases can also contribute to climate change. For this reason, emissions are often converted into carbon dioxide equivalent (CO₂e) so different greenhouse gases can be represented using a common measurement.

Ways to Reduce Your Carbon Footprint

After calculating your emissions, the next step is considering ways to reduce them. Simple changes can include improving energy efficiency, reducing unnecessary vehicle trips, using public transportation, walking or cycling when practical, reducing energy waste, and making thoughtful purchasing decisions.

At home, energy-efficient appliances, improved insulation, efficient heating and cooling, and responsible electricity use can help lower energy-related emissions.

Transportation is another important area. Combining trips, carpooling, choosing public transportation, and reducing unnecessary air travel can potentially lower transportation-related emissions.

The most effective approach depends on your individual circumstances. A calculator helps you identify areas where changes may have the greatest impact.
